import {
Inviter,
SessionState,
UserAgent,
UserAgentDelegate,
UserAgentOptions,
Web
} from "sip.js";
import { WPhoneConfig, InviterConfig } from "./types";
export function createInviter(inviterParam: InviterConfig) {
const target = UserAgent.makeURI(inviterParam.targetAOR);
const inviter = new Inviter(inviterParam.userAgent, target, {
extraHeaders: inviterParam.extraHeaders,
sessionDescriptionHandlerOptions: {
constraints: {
audio: true,
video: false
}
}
});
inviter.stateChange.addListener((state: SessionState) => {
console.log(`Session state changed to ${state}`);
switch (state) {
case SessionState.Initial:
break;
case SessionState.Establishing:
break;
case SessionState.Established:
const sessionDescriptionHandler = inviter.sessionDescriptionHandler as Web.SessionDescriptionHandler;
assignStream(sessionDescriptionHandler.remoteMediaStream, inviterParam.audioElement);
sessionDescriptionHandler.peerConnectionDelegate = {
// NOTE:: SB - Allowing to get onTrack events to know when a new track added to the peer connection.
// When we get a new track event, we'll assign the last new remote media stream to HTML audio element source.
// Mostly will occur when RE-INVITEs will happen.
ontrack(event: Event) {
assignStream(sessionDescriptionHandler.remoteMediaStream, inviterParam.audioElement);
}
}
break;
case SessionState.Terminating:
// fall through
case SessionState.Terminated:
// cleanupMedia();
console.log("");
break;
default:
throw new Error("Unknown session state.");
}
});
return inviter;
}
export function createUserAgentOptions(config: WPhoneConfig,
delegate: UserAgentDelegate): UserAgentOptions {
return {
uri: UserAgent.makeURI(`sip:${config.username}@${config.domain}`),
delegate,
displayName: config.displayName,
authorizationUsername: config.username,
authorizationPassword: config.secret,
transportOptions: {
server: config.server
}
};
}
// Assign a MediaStream to an HTMLMediaElement and update if tracks change.
export function assignStream(stream: MediaStream, element: HTMLMediaElement): void {
// Set element source.
element.autoplay = true; // Safari does not allow calling .play() from a non user action
element.srcObject = stream;
// Load and start playback of media.
element.play().catch((error: Error) => {
console.error("Failed to play media");
console.error(error);
});
// If a track is added, load and restart playback of media.
stream.onaddtrack = (): void => {
element.load(); // Safari does not work otheriwse
element.play().catch((error: Error) => {
console.error("Failed to play remote media on add track");
console.error(error);
});
};
// If a track is removed, load and restart playback of media.
stream.onremovetrack = (): void => {
element.load(); // Safari does not work otheriwse
element.play().catch((error: Error) => {
console.error("Failed to play remote media on remove track");
console.error(error);
});
};
}
